Could anybody please let me know how to re-schedule the job:

SAP_REORG_NONE_R3_STAT_DB

The job was initially set up by a user who has left, so i'm trying to re-schedule.

I have re-scheduled the job : -

SAP_COLLECTOR_FOR_NONE_R3_STAT, which manages the above, but it doesn't create the SAP_REORG_NONE_R3_STAT_DB job as I was expecting.

You could use SM36->Standard Jobs to define the characteristics of the job (i.e. name, ABAP, default variant, frequency) and then re-schedule it from there. If you ever lose the released version of the job again, you would simply go into SM36->Standard Jobs and re-schedule it again.

SAP_REORG_NONE_R3_STAT_DB has a very simple definition - it executes ABAP RSN3_AGGR_REORG on a daily basis. This would be easy to define in SM36->Standard Jobs and make scheduling it easy.

We use SM36->Standard Jobs to define all our housekeeping jobs and then schedule them from there.
